How Does Northfield Savings Bank Support Local Life?

The bank’s commitment extends beyond just offering accounts; it’s about being a genuine part of the community, which is why they have a strong presence in central Vermont and Chittenden County too. They are quite proud to be the largest bank with its main office in Vermont, serving over 35,000 people across 14 different locations. This extensive reach means that many individuals and small businesses in these areas rely on Northfield Savings Bank for their day-to-day money handling and their plans for the future. A Look at Northfield's Community Roots

While Northfield Savings Bank has its specific service areas, the name "Northfield" itself brings to mind a particular kind of place, and it's worth noting that there's a city named Northfield in Minnesota. This city, located mostly in Rice County with a small part in Dakota County, is known for its distinct small-town appeal and a deep sense of history. It’s a place that seems to hold onto its past while also offering a lively present, which is pretty interesting, you know?

This Minnesota city had a population of 20,790 people at the 2020 census, showing it’s a community of a decent size, yet it keeps that charming, welcoming feel. Situated in the southeast part of the state, it’s a spot that truly embraces its local character. The city is also known for hosting events that are truly memorable, drawing people in for a specific happening and then encouraging them to linger for the broader experience. For example, the "Defeat of Jesse James Days" is a well-known event that celebrates a piece of local history with a lot of community involvement. There's also the "Bridge Chamber Music" series, which adds a cultural touch to the town’s offerings.
